Master's degree in Occupational Therapy, active Occupational Therapist license and 1+ year of Occupational Therapy experience required. Applicants who do not meet these qualifications will not be considered.

A part-time Occupational Therapist (OT) opportunity is available to support a K-12 school setting. This contract position serves one student with a minimal caseload of 1-3 hours per week, providing targeted therapy to help the student achieve their educational and developmental goals.

Location: Plymouth, NH (outside district assignment)
Job Duration: Current School Year (CSY)
Schedule: Part-time, 1 to 3 hours weekly

Key Responsibilities:

  • Deliver specialized occupational therapy services aligned with the students Individualized Education Program (IEP) needs
  • Collaborate with school staff to integrate therapy goals within the classroom environment
  • Monitor progress and provide regular documentation and reports
  • Communicate effectively with teachers, parents, and administration to ensure continuity of care

Qualifications:

  • Valid Occupational Therapist licensure in New Hampshire
  • Experience providing occupational therapy services within school or educational settings preferred
  • Ability to work independently with minimal supervision
  • Strong communication skills and collaborative approach

Additional Information:
The position is part of a regional school districts contract and requires traveling to Plymouth, NH for service delivery. The caseload consists of one student, making this an ideal role for an OT seeking part-time, flexible work in an educational setting.
